引言
随着人工智能技术的飞速发展,大模型(Large Language Models,LLMs)已经成为人工智能领域的一个重要分支。大模型通过在大量数据上进行预训练,能够理解和生成自然语言,并在各个领域展现出强大的应用潜力。本文将深入探讨大模型背后的核心知识点,为读者揭示构建未来智能的基石。
一、大模型的基本概念
1.1 什么是大模型?
大模型是指那些在预训练阶段使用了海量数据,并且模型参数数量巨大的语言模型。这些模型通常能够理解和生成复杂、多样化的自然语言内容。
1.2 大模型的分类
- 预训练模型:如BERT、GPT等,在大规模数据集上进行预训练,然后可以根据具体任务进行微调。
- 特定领域模型:针对特定领域进行优化,如法律、医学等。
二、大模型的核心技术
2.1 预训练技术
预训练是使模型在大规模数据集上学习通用语言表示的过程。常见的预训练技术包括:
- 自监督学习:通过无监督学习技术,如掩码语言模型(Masked Language Model,MLM)等,使模型自动学习语言特征。
- 迁移学习:利用预训练模型在特定任务上的表现,迁移到其他相关任务上。
2.2 微调技术
微调是在预训练模型的基础上,针对特定任务进行调整的过程。常见的微调技术包括:
- 微调参数:通过在特定任务数据上训练,调整预训练模型的参数。
- 多任务学习:同时学习多个任务,使模型在不同任务上都能取得较好的表现。
2.3 Prompt学习
Prompt学习是一种通过设计特定的输入提示来引导模型生成期望输出的技术。它包括以下方面:
- Prompt设计:设计有效的输入提示,以引导模型生成特定内容。
- Prompt优化:通过不断优化输入提示,提高模型输出的质量和相关性。
三、大模型的应用场景
3.1 自然语言处理
- 文本生成:如文章、报告、邮件等。
- 文本分类:如情感分析、垃圾邮件检测等。
- 机器翻译:如将一种语言翻译成另一种语言。
3.2 人工智能助手
- 智能客服:自动回答用户问题。
- 智能写作:辅助用户撰写文章、报告等。
3.3 智能推荐
- 个性化推荐:根据用户喜好推荐内容。
四、大模型的挑战与未来发展趋势
4.1 挑战
- 数据隐私:大模型在训练过程中需要大量数据,可能涉及用户隐私问题。
- 模型可解释性:大模型的决策过程难以解释,可能导致误判。
- 计算资源:大模型训练和推理需要大量的计算资源。
4.2 未来发展趋势
- 更高效、更节能的模型:如轻量级模型、低能耗模型等。
- 跨模态大模型:结合自然语言处理、计算机视觉等领域,实现更强大的功能。
- 可解释性增强:提高模型的可解释性,增强用户信任。
结论
大模型作为人工智能领域的一个重要分支,正在引领着人工智能技术的发展。通过对大模型背后的核心知识点的深入了解,我们能够更好地把握未来智能的发展趋势,为构建更加智能化的未来奠定坚实基础。